/**
* GtkPasswordEntry :
*
* A single - line text entry widget for entering passwords and other secrets .
*
* < picture >
* < source srcset = " password - entry - dark . png " media = " ( prefers - color - scheme : dark ) " >
* < img alt = " An example GtkPasswordEntry " src = " password - entry . png " >
* < / picture >
*
* It does not show its contents in clear text , does not allow to copy it
* to the clipboard , and it shows a warning when Caps Lock is engaged . If
* the underlying platform allows it , ` GtkPasswordEntry ` will also place
* the text in a non - pageable memory area , to avoid it being written out
* to disk by the operating system .
*
* Optionally , it can offer a way to reveal the contents in clear text .
*
* ` GtkPasswordEntry ` provides only minimal API and should be used with
* the [ iface @ Gtk . Editable ] API .
*
* # CSS Nodes
*
* ` ` `
* entry . password
* ╰ ─ ─ text
* ├ ─ ─ image . caps - lock - indicator
* ┊
* ` ` `
*
* ` GtkPasswordEntry ` has a single CSS node with name entry that carries
* a . passwordstyle class . The text Css node below it has a child with
* name image and style class . caps - lock - indicator for the Caps Lock
* icon , and possibly other children .
*
* # Accessibility
*
* ` GtkPasswordEntry ` uses the [ enum @ Gtk . AccessibleRole . text_box ] role .
*/

/**
* gtk_password_entry_set_show_peek_icon :
* @ entry : a ` GtkPasswordEntry `
* @ show_peek_icon : whether to show the peek icon
*
* Sets whether the entry should have a clickable icon
* to reveal the contents .
*
* Setting this to % FALSE also hides the text again .
*/
void
gtk_password_entry_set_show_peek_icon (GtkPasswordEntry *entry,
gboolean show_peek_icon)
{
g_return_if_fail (GTK_IS_PASSWORD_ENTRY (entry));
show_peek_icon = !!show_peek_icon;
if (show_peek_icon == (entry->peek_icon != NULL))
return ;
if (show_peek_icon)
{
GtkGesture *press;
entry->peek_icon = gtk_image_new_from_icon_name ("view-reveal-symbolic" );
gtk_widget_set_tooltip_text (entry->peek_icon, _("Show Text" ));
gtk_widget_set_parent (entry->peek_icon, GTK_WIDGET (entry));
press = gtk_gesture_click_new ();
g_signal_connect (press, "pressed" ,
G_CALLBACK (gtk_password_entry_icon_press), entry);
g_signal_connect_swapped (press, "released" ,
G_CALLBACK (gtk_password_entry_toggle_peek), entry);
gtk_widget_add_controller (entry->peek_icon, GTK_EVENT_CONTROLLER (press));
g_signal_connect (entry->entry, "notify::visibility" ,
G_CALLBACK (visibility_toggled), entry);
visibility_toggled (G_OBJECT (entry->entry), NULL, entry);
}
else
{
g_clear_pointer (&entry->peek_icon, gtk_widget_unparent);
gtk_text_set_visibility (GTK_TEXT (entry->entry), FALSE );
g_signal_handlers_disconnect_by_func (entry->entry,
visibility_toggled,
entry);
}
if (entry->keyboard)
caps_lock_state_changed (entry->keyboard, NULL, GTK_WIDGET (entry));
g_object_notify_by_pspec (G_OBJECT (entry), props[PROP_SHOW_PEEK_ICON]);
}
